Understanding Nexium and Pepcid

When it comes to treating acid reflux and heartburn, two commonly prescribed medications are Nexium and Pepcid. Both of these medications work in different ways to reduce the production of stomach acid and provide relief from these symptoms.

Nexium is a proton pump inhibitor (PPI) that works by blocking the enzyme in the stomach wall responsible for producing acid. By reducing the amount of acid in the stomach, Nexium helps to alleviate symptoms such as heartburn and acid reflux. It is commonly prescribed for conditions like g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D) and stomach ulcers.

Pepcid, on the other hand, is a histamine-2 receptor antagonist (H2 blocker) that works by reducing the production of acid in the stomach. By blocking the action of histamine, Pepcid helps to decrease the amount of acid released into the stomach. It is often used to treat conditions like acid indigestion and sour stomach.

While both Nexium and Pepcid are effective in reducing stomach acid, they do so through different mechanisms. This is why some people may wonder if it is safe or beneficial to take these medications together.

How Nexium and Pepcid Work

When it comes to treating acid reflux and heartburn, understanding how medications like Nexium and Pepcid work is important. These medications belong to different drug classes and work in different ways to provide relief.

  • Nexium: Nexium is a proton pump inhibitor (PPI) that works by reducing the production of stomach acid. It does this by blocking the enzyme in the stomach wall responsible for acid production. By decreasing the amount of acid in the stomach, Nexium helps alleviate symptoms such as heartburn, acid reflux, and stomach ulcers.
  • Pepcid: Pepcid, on the other hand, is an H2 blocker that works by reducing the amount of acid produced by the stomach. It does this by blocking the histamine receptors in the stomach, which are responsible for triggering acid production. By inhibiting these receptors, Pepcid helps relieve symptoms of acid reflux and heartburn.

Combining Nexium and Pepcid can be considered in certain cases where a person may require additional acid suppression. However, it’s important to note that combining these medications is not always necessary or recommended. Consulting with a healthcare professional is crucial to determine the appropriate treatment plan for individual needs.
